Liquefied natural gas (LNG) Many people in need of energy are located far from gas fields, making pipelines too impractical or costly to build. To get around this problem, gas can be cooled to make a liquid, shrinking its volume for easier, safer storage and shipping overseas.

  LNG is natural gas that has been cooled to 260° F ( 162° C), changing it from a gas into a liquid that is 1/600th of its original volume. This dramatic reduction allows it to be shipped safely and efficiently aboard specially designed LNG vessels.

LNG safety. Gas carriers around the world have been using liquefied natural gas (LNG) as part of their fuel source for decades. The safety record of LNG carriers is extremely good. Even though most of the principles remain the same, using LNG as fuel for conventional ships introduces new systems on board together with their associated risks.

Gases are always liquefied for transportation in bulk ­ simply because more cargo can be fitted in a given volume. Typically, but dependent upon the product, 1 volume of liquefied petroleum gas (LPG) is equivalent to over 250 volumes of vapour and 1 volume of liquefied natural gas (LNG) equivalent to 600 volumes of vapour.

  LNG stands for Liquefied Natural Gas or Liquid Natural Gas, and as the name implies, it is traditional natural gas which has been cooled to the point of liquefaction. Liquefied natural gas is odorless, colorless, non corrosive, and non toxic. It is also much more dense than gaseous natural gas.

The LNGTainer System makes distributing liquefied natural gas to new gas consumers both easy and cost efficient. The prohibitive cost of special vessels, terminals, truck and storage tanks designed solely for LNG distribution has thus far prevented its wider use. Until now, LNG has been unloaded and filled at every stage of the distribution chain.
